Note: There are always options for shorter loops and
shortcuts to allow for slower runners (or longer loops for
the faster runners). This works especially well on lunch time
runs such as Fridays.
Monday
Steady to brisk run leave from 5 Monro Street (meet at the
patio, back of the house) from 5.00pm and leave approx 5.15/20.
Time between 40 and 70min with long and short options. Usually
all off-road Ross Creek, bike tracks, McGouns and home option
via Malvern street/Bullock track. As Winter approaches a good
headlight is recommended (+100 lumens) and reflective gear.
We will continue off-road if all runners have lights otherwise
those without lights will do more road running including Leith
Valley.
Tuesday
Logan Park meet outside (next to) the Hill City Clubrooms
(Logan park outside Athletic track at corner of football field)
@ 5pm for 5.15pm start if possible.
Tempo, for 1.4km reps around road loop or Fartlek on the grass
such as 12, 10, 8, 6, 4, 2, 1, 1 minutes hard or different
timed series. Variable volume for beginners and elite runners.
Wednesday
Lunch time run meet 12.45pm at 5 Monro Street and leave 1pm
sharp for 50 to 70min steady run in Ross Creek + McGouns with
options for slow/fast runners.
Thursday
For Monday and Thursday please bring a good headlight (>1
watt), reflective gear, wear white or bright colours.
Meet 5pm leave sharply 5.15pm from 5 Monro Street.
Hilly run or repeat hills/high knees/bounding/technique,
meet as for Monday, options for beginners/fast slow runners
(40 to 120minutes). At present been doing a long slow climb
Nicolls Falls to Flagstaff and home (about 90 mins)
Friday
Rest or (steady recovery run) from 5 Monro Street meet 12.30pm
sharp (50 to 70 minutes) into Ross Creek/Polworth road/MTB
tracks and home
Saturday
Race/Rest/Tempo run/Long run/Bike/MTB on own usually
Sunday
Rest/Race/Long run 70-120+min a number of groups leave at
different times/long bike ride/MTB
